Senior AWS Developer/Dev Ops
Location
United States + 1 moreAll locations: United States, Canada
Posted
15 days ago
Salary
Not specified
No structured requirement data.
Job Description
Role Description
We are looking for a Senior AWS Developer/DevOps to join our team to help build, maintain, and optimize our cloud development ecosystem. You won’t just be writing functions; you will be architecting resilient, event-driven systems and building the "paved road" for our development team through robust Infrastructure as Code (IaC) and CI/CD automation.
Key Responsibilities
- Infrastructure as Code (IaC): Develop repeatable, version-controlled infrastructure environments (e.g., OpenTofu, Terraform, Terragrunt).
- Architect AWS Cloud Solutions: Design and implement highly scalable services using AWS Lambda, API Gateway, S3, Step Functions as well as non-serverless AWS.
- Automate Everything: Build and refine CI/CD pipelines using GitHub Actions to ensure seamless, safe, and automated deployments.
- Collaborate & Mentor: Drive technical best practices, conduct code reviews, and help elevate the team’s cloud proficiency.
Qualifications
- 5+ years of experience in cloud-native software development, with a deep focus on the AWS ecosystem.
- Deep AWS knowledge, with a proven track record of optimizing Lambda performance, designing RESTful APIs via API Gateway, and managing lifecycle policies in S3.
- Experience implementing complex business logic using Step Functions.
- IaC Proficiency, with a demonstrated ability to define infrastructure as code.
- CI/CD expertise, with comfortability writing custom GitHub Actions workflows that include automated linting, security scanning, and multi-stage deployments.
- A growth mindset, where you value simplicity, "fail-fast" development, and documentation.
Benefits
- Salary range of $150,000-$180,000*
- Flexible, remote-first work environment (company headquartered in Chicago)
- Paid Time Off
- Company-provided computer (Mac or PC, depending on preference)
- Home office set-up assistance
- Virtual and in-person social events
- Training & certification reimbursement
- Professional opportunities at fast-growing company with a sky-is-the-limit mindset
Job Requirements
- 5+ years of experience in cloud-native software development, with a deep focus on the AWS ecosystem.
- Deep AWS knowledge, with a proven track record of optimizing Lambda performance, designing RESTful APIs via API Gateway, and managing lifecycle policies in S3.
- Experience implementing complex business logic using Step Functions.
- IaC Proficiency, with a demonstrated ability to define infrastructure as code.
- CI/CD expertise, with comfortability writing custom GitHub Actions workflows that include automated linting, security scanning, and multi-stage deployments.
- A growth mindset, where you value simplicity, "fail-fast" development, and documentation.
Benefits
- Salary range of $150,000-$180,000*
- Flexible, remote-first work environment (company headquartered in Chicago)
- Paid Time Off
- Company-provided computer (Mac or PC, depending on preference)
- Home office set-up assistance
- Virtual and in-person social events
- Training & certification reimbursement
- Professional opportunities at fast-growing company with a sky-is-the-limit mindset
Related Guides
Related Categories
Related Job Pages
More DevOps Engineer Jobs
DevOps/Cloud Engineer designing cloud-native infrastructures
Senior Site Reliability Engineer for SS&C Technologies' global cloud-based infrastructure
Senior DevOps Engineer
FetLifeOur mission is to help everyone feel comfortable with who they are sexually by connecting and educating kinksters in a safe, open, and supportive environment.
The Senior DevOps Engineer will upgrade infrastructure, manage databases, improve automated processes, and enhance security for a high-traffic Rails application.
Site Reliability Engineer (Senior or Staff), Fabric
MongoDBA developer data platform built on the leading modern database.
As a Staff Site Reliability Engineer, you will empower developers by optimizing MongoDB Atlas, ensuring seamless performance across multiple cloud platforms while fostering a supportive culture.